תוכן עניינים:

חדר חכם: 8 שלבים
חדר חכם: 8 שלבים

וִידֵאוֹ: חדר חכם: 8 שלבים

וִידֵאוֹ: חדר חכם: 8 שלבים
וִידֵאוֹ: התקנת מתג חכם לתאורה 2024, נוֹבֶמבֶּר
Anonim
חדר חכם
חדר חכם

האם אי פעם בא לך לשכב במיטה שלך ולא לרצות לקום? האם אי פעם מתחשק לך לקום ולפתוח את התריסים שלך? אז יש לי את הפתרון המושלם עבורך. היכרות עם Smartroom, קח שליטה על החדר שלך עם הטלפון הנייד, הטאבלט או אפילו המחשב שלך!

אספקה

בשלב הבא אציג את רשימת החומרים הדרושים לך. החשוב מכל תצטרך להיות עם פטל פטל והמחשב שלך.

שלב 1: איסוף כל החומרים המתכלים שלך

אוספים את כל הציוד שלך
אוספים את כל הציוד שלך
אסוף את כל הציוד שלך
אסוף את כל הציוד שלך
אוספים את כל הציוד שלך
אוספים את כל הציוד שלך

הכי חשוב, הציוד! שמתי הכל בגיליון אלקטרוני של אקסל.

שלב 2: בניית הדיור

בניית הדיור
בניית הדיור
בניית הדיור
בניית הדיור
בניית הדיור
בניית הדיור

עבור הדיור השתמשתי בלוח MDF בגודל 122 ס"מ על 61 ס"מ, אתה יכול למצוא אותם בכל חנות עשה זאת בעצמך. חותכים אותם בעזרת מסור להב עיגול עם המידות בציור. לאחר מכן מודבקים הלוחות יחד עם הדבק Soudal Fix All. הציור הוא אופציונלי אך נותן לו מגע נחמד:), השתמשתי בסוגי הצבע כפי שניתן לראות בתמונות למעלה. עבור הווילונות הכנתי יריעה אחת מבד הדק ביותר שהיה לי. היה לי גם צינור פלסטיק מונח בזווית של 90 מעלות. אני חותך אותם לחתיכות כדי שהחיישנים יתאימו.

שלב 3: יצירת המעגל

עושים את המעגל
עושים את המעגל
עושים את המעגל
עושים את המעגל

זהו אינו מעגל החשמל הקטן ביותר אך זה מה שהופך את הפרויקט הזה למהנה. נסה להימנע מחציית חוטים קופצים. החוטים שאינם מגיעים לאותו קרש לחם צריכים להיות ארוכים יותר. אתה יכול להלחים שני חוטים או לחבר זכר לחוטים נקביים זה עם זה.

שלב 4: הורד את הקוד מ- Github

אתה יכול להוריד את הקוד לפרויקט זה ב- Github שלי, הקישור הוא https://github.com/howest-mct/1920-1mct-project1-V… לחץ על קוד והורד את ה backend וה- frontend.

צור חיבור SSH בין ה- PI שלך לבין קוד Visual Studio, אם אינך יודע כיצד, הנה מדריך קטן.

בקוד VS, צור תיקייה חדשה וקרא לה איך שאתה רוצה, ברצינות, זה לא משנה. הדבק את כל הקבצים מה- Backend בתיקייה זו. חלק ראשון נעשה. כעת נווט אל/var/www/על קוד VC והדבק שם את קבצי החזית. חלק הקידוד הסתיים כעת!

שלב 5: צור את מסד הנתונים MySQL

צור את מסד הנתונים MySQL
צור את מסד הנתונים MySQL
צור את מסד הנתונים MySQL
צור את מסד הנתונים MySQL

התוכנית בה אני משתמשת ליצירת מאגרי מידע היא MySQL Workbench. אתה יכול למצוא את הקישור להורדה כאן.

צור חיבור אלחוטי, עיין בהגדרות שלי, ודא ששם המארח SSH הוא כתובת ה- IP של ה- RPi שלך.

כעת עבור אל הסמל תחת קובץ בפינה השמאלית העליונה של המסך, לחץ עליו, הוא אמור לפתוח קובץ SQL רגיל. הדבק שם את קוד smartroomdb.txt והפעל אותו (הברק הצהוב). עכשיו אתה זהוב!

שלב 6: בדיקת החדר החכם

בדיקת החדר החכם
בדיקת החדר החכם
בדיקת החדר החכם
בדיקת החדר החכם

כעת, לאחר שרוב החלקים הטכניים הסתיימו, עבור אל התיקיה שזה עתה נוצרת ב- VS Code והפעל את app.py. יש סמל התחלה קטן בפינה השמאלית העליונה. כעת עבור לדפדפן והקלד את כתובת ה- IP של ה- RPi שלך. אתה אמור לראות את האתר.

אתר זה נוצר קודם כל בנייד! אז כן אתה יכול להשתמש בפרויקט הזה בטלפון שלך. פשוט הקלד את כתובת ה- IP של RPi שלך.

אתה יכול גם לתת לפרויקט להתחיל כאשר ה- Raspberry Pi שלך מתחיל. אם תרצה לעשות זאת יהיה עליך ליצור שירות של app1.py. עקוב אחר הדרכה זו

יהיה עליך לשנות main.py ל- app1.py ולשנות את הספרייה לספרייה שבה נמצאת app1.py. בדוק אם הכל עובד במעגל החשמלי. אם כן, המשך לשלב הבא!

שלב 7: הכנסת המעגל בתוך הדיור שלך

ה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ך
הכנסת המעגל לתוך הדיור שלך

הגעת לחלק האחרון, מזל טוב!

יהיה צורך לקדוח שני חורים בקירות. אחד שבו החבישה ואחת מתחת לשולחן. אתה יכול להשתמש במקדח רגיל בשביל זה. לאחר מכן לוח הלחם עם MCP3008 וה- L293D נכנסים מתחת לשידה ולוח הלחם השני מתחת למיטה. ניהול הכבלים תלוי בך. השתמשתי בכמה כריות דביקות שמצאתי בחנות DIY המקומית שלי (Hubo).

שלב 8: תהנה מחדר החכם

תהנה מחדר החכם!
תהנה מחדר החכם!
תהנה מחדר החכם!
תהנה מחדר החכם!
תהנה מחדר החכם!
תהנה מחדר החכם!

כעת אתה מוכן לחלוטין להשתמש בחדר החכם, לא תקום יותר לפתוח את התריסים שלך!

מוּמלָץ: